1 |
commit: 196c2bde7c25fcf057d5e6a3a497cfb2aced8ae6 |
2 |
Author: Patrick Lauer <patrick <AT> gentoo <DOT> org> |
3 |
AuthorDate: Sat Oct 29 09:56:26 2016 +0000 |
4 |
Commit: Patrick Lauer <patrick <AT> gentoo <DOT> org> |
5 |
CommitDate: Sat Oct 29 09:56:40 2016 +0000 |
6 |
URL: https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=196c2bde |
7 |
|
8 |
app-admin/logstash-bin: Fix initscript some more #598422 |
9 |
|
10 |
Package-Manager: portage-2.3.2 |
11 |
|
12 |
app-admin/logstash-bin/files/{logstash.initd2 => logstash.initd3} | 4 ++-- |
13 |
.../{logstash-bin-5.0.0.ebuild => logstash-bin-5.0.0-r1.ebuild} | 2 +- |
14 |
2 files changed, 3 insertions(+), 3 deletions(-) |
15 |
|
16 |
diff --git a/app-admin/logstash-bin/files/logstash.initd2 b/app-admin/logstash-bin/files/logstash.initd3 |
17 |
similarity index 93% |
18 |
rename from app-admin/logstash-bin/files/logstash.initd2 |
19 |
rename to app-admin/logstash-bin/files/logstash.initd3 |
20 |
index bd0cc91..b7a8eab 100644 |
21 |
--- a/app-admin/logstash-bin/files/logstash.initd2 |
22 |
+++ b/app-admin/logstash-bin/files/logstash.initd3 |
23 |
@@ -15,7 +15,7 @@ LS_OPEN_FILES=${LS_OPEN_FILES:-16384} |
24 |
KILL_ON_STOP_TIMEOUT=${KILL_ON_STOP_TIMEOUT:-0} |
25 |
|
26 |
command="/opt/logstash/bin/logstash" |
27 |
-command_args="--config ${LS_CONF_DIR} --log ${LS_LOG_FILE} ${LS_OPTS}" |
28 |
+command_args="--path.config ${LS_CONF_DIR} --path.logs ${LS_LOG_FILE} ${LS_OPTS}" |
29 |
command_background="true" |
30 |
pidfile=${LS_PIDFILE:-"/run/logstash/logstash.pid"} |
31 |
|
32 |
@@ -36,7 +36,7 @@ checkconfig() { |
33 |
fi |
34 |
|
35 |
ebegin "Checking your configuration" |
36 |
- ${command} ${command_args} --configtest |
37 |
+ ${command} ${command_args} --config.test_and_exit |
38 |
eend $? "Configuration error. Please fix your configuration files." |
39 |
} |
40 |
|
41 |
|
42 |
diff --git a/app-admin/logstash-bin/logstash-bin-5.0.0.ebuild b/app-admin/logstash-bin/logstash-bin-5.0.0-r1.ebuild |
43 |
similarity index 96% |
44 |
rename from app-admin/logstash-bin/logstash-bin-5.0.0.ebuild |
45 |
rename to app-admin/logstash-bin/logstash-bin-5.0.0-r1.ebuild |
46 |
index be89a3b..669a13e 100644 |
47 |
--- a/app-admin/logstash-bin/logstash-bin-5.0.0.ebuild |
48 |
+++ b/app-admin/logstash-bin/logstash-bin-5.0.0-r1.ebuild |
49 |
@@ -46,7 +46,7 @@ src_install() { |
50 |
newins "${FILESDIR}/${MY_PN}.logrotate" "${MY_PN}" |
51 |
|
52 |
newconfd "${FILESDIR}/${MY_PN}.confd" "${MY_PN}" |
53 |
- newinitd "${FILESDIR}/${MY_PN}.initd2" "${MY_PN}" |
54 |
+ newinitd "${FILESDIR}/${MY_PN}.initd3" "${MY_PN}" |
55 |
} |
56 |
|
57 |
pkg_postinst() { |